City/town information
Dunedin (pronounced DONE-EE-DIN) is a quaint, small town full of culture, unique small businesses, happy people and the Pinellas Trail. Any given day you will find locals and tourists alike strolling downtown enjoying a homemade ice cream cone, shopping in our unique stores or sitting under a shade tree at one of our many parks watching the day go by.
From the moment you first enter Dunedin you will feel at home. There is an indescribable sense of comfort, quaintness and charm in our delightful Dunedin. Don't let this convince you that we are a sleepy Southern town though... Dunedin, Florida offers some of the best dining in Tampa bay, world class major league baseball, art and culture, and even the #1 Beach in America! All of this with a touch of Southern charm.
The city of Dunedin, Florida is the Home of Honeymoon Island, the #1 state park in the Florida. The Island boasts clear emerald green waters with baby powder like sandy beaches on the Gulf of Mexico. For the avid biker or walker there are miles of nature trails through the island just waiting to be explored.
Honeymoon Island and Caladesi Island, its' neighbor, are a step back in time into a world of old Florida beaches before condos and hotels were developed. Both these islands are all natural and unspoiled by any development.
